If you’re on PC and use a keyboard to play FIFA 21, you can perform a chip shot by holding down your player modifier key and tapping your shoot hotkey. The success of your shots will depend on your angle of approach and technique.

PlayStation users need to hold down L1 and press circle to perform a chipshot, while Xbox players can score chip shots by holding down LB and pressing B to shoot. Nintendo Switch players can score chip shots by holding down L and pressing A.May 13, 2021

How do you chip in a penalty?

To do a chipped or panenka penalty, aiming is the same, but when powering up your shot, hold L1 on PlayStation or LB on Xbox to attempt to dink the ball over the goalkeeper.

How to Do Chip Shots

A chip shot is a type of shot that lifts the ball high in the air using a short kick. Also called a lob, the shot allows the ball to go over the goalkeeper and score a goal.

Summary

The chip shot is performed by holding the L1 button and pressing the shoot button (L1 + ◯). If done correctly, your player will kick the ball from underneath and give the ball more lift to go over the opponent’s goalie.

Tips for Chip Shots

The chip shot is very effective during one-on-one situations against the opponent’s goalkeeper. You can use the shot to easily score against opponents who tend to move their goalie too far off the goal line.

How to shoot in FIFA 21?

The basic shot in FIFA 21 is done by pressing the Circle Button (B Button on Xbox). To shoot effectively you must press and hold this button to fill up a meter which you will see at the bottom of the screen. The longer you hold the shoot button the higher the ball will travel and the harder the shot will be.

FIFA 21 skill moves star ratings explained

In the full list of FIFA 21 skill moves below, the skills are divided by the star rating your players need to pull them off. You can check this by going into an individual players' information, then looking for the star rating, alongside their weak foot rating.

1 Star Skill Moves

These are the basic tricks that anyone can pull off, including goalkeepers. Though we wouldn't advise doing tricks with 'keepers, for obvious reasons...

2 Star Skill Moves

99% of outfield players have two star skills so you shouldn't have any trouble doing these ones. Note the Drag Back, which has changed execution since last year.

3 Star Skill Moves

Now we're getting to the good stuff. Most midfielders and forwards will have three star skills, which includes some classics like the Roulette and Heel Chop.

4 Star Skill Moves

This is where you can start looking super fancy because there are a lot of four star moves, including the Rainbow Flick, a true showboating move.

5 Star Skill Moves

These skills can only be pulled off by the very best; Neymar, Vinicius Jr, Aiden Mcgeady... that tier of player.

5 Star Juggling Tricks

When players with five star skills juggle the ball, they can also do special moves like these with the ball in mid-air.
